From the Author:
Chris Riddell is the author of The Da Vinci Cod and Other Illustrations for Unwritten Books, Ottoline and the Yellow Cat, and the Edge Chronicles, which includes Beyond the Deep Woods. He has won the Kate Greenaway Medal twice and Nestlé Smarties Children's Book Prizes seven times, and is the acclaimed political cartoonist for the Observer.
From School Library Journal:
Kindergarten-Grade 2 Beginning with Mr. Underbed, Jim discovers a host of cheerful, baggy-looking monsters residing in his bedroom, all of whom want to sleep in his bed. Jim decides to sleep under the bed. There is not much here. Although children may find the pictures amusing, Mayer's There's a Nightmare in My Closet (Dial, 1968) and Sendak's Where the Wild Things Are (Harper, 1963) are preferable. This first writing effort by Riddell seems lacking in plot and thematic content, and the brightly-colored watercolors include some garish shades and unappealing combinations of colors. Ronald A.
